The Advisory Committee reviewed FY27 budget requests, including $739,282 for Town Hall, $113,000 for Annual Town Meeting, and $854,608 for the Reserve Fund. Members unanimously approved recommendations on four warrant items, including limits of $265,000 for the Building Department Revolving Fund and $80,000 for the Center for Active Living Revolving Fund.

The committee’s budget review helps shape funding requests that will go before Annual Town Meeting, but the meeting did not finalize the town’s full FY27 budget. The committee also unanimously recommended several warrant actions, including appointing a member to the Hannah Lincoln Whiting Fund committee and authorizing liability coverage for certain Department of Conservation and Recreation work. Other updates included a possible $70 million debt issuance for a third transmission line, exploration of subsidized composting, and a federal grant for 10 additional electric school buses.
